Madhya Pradesh minister Sajjan Singh Verma courted controversy on Monday after he opined that the mentality of the BJP leaders is similar to that of dogs. Verma's comment came after the opposition party mocked the Kamal Nath government's decision to transfer 46 police dogs along with their handlers across the state.

As per the government order, handlers of tracker, sniffer and narco dogs from 23 battalion dog squad have been given new postings in different districts. The order evoked sharp criticism from the BJP with party vice president Vijesh Lunawat tweeting: “The great Kamal Nath government did not even spare dogs from the transfer business.”

Reacting to the opposition criticism, Verma said: “Their mentality is similar to that of dogs. What else they can do?”

Verma's comment elicited sharp response from the saffron party which accused the minister of calling their leaders 'dogs'.

“If Sajjan Singh Verma is calling us dogs, I would like to tell him that 'yes, we are dogs'. We are faithful dogs of the people of Madhya Pradesh and we will keep raising our voices for our people and our security forces,” BJP MLA Rameshwar Sharma was quoted as saying by ANI.

According to reports, the current transfers were necessitated due to the ageing of some dogs serving at the chief minister's residence.
